  • The cost of code is partially writing it and partially maintaining it.
    • It used to be that writing it was so costly that it dominated the cost of maintaining.
    • But now the cost of writing it is so low that the cost of maintaining, on a relative basis, dominates.
    • That means that sometimes checking in code is a liability–now you have to keep it up to date.
